Thin blood is a thoroughly captivating contemporary whodunnitstyled thriller set in melbourne, victoria, and is the debut novel by australian author vicki tyley. What starts as a typical missing persons case soon evolves into a fullblown homicide investigation when forensics uncover blood traces and darkblonde hairs in the boot of the missing womans car.
